What You Will Do With UsRisk.net is looking for a Networks & Benchmarking Editor to help develop our growing portfolio of data and benchmarking products - one of our top strategic priorities.
You will be responsible for building and maintaining relationships with key stakeholders in the financial services industry, primarily senior risk managers at banks, buy-side firms, and market infrastructure providers. You will also help shape the products and coverage that we offer to those contributors and our subscribers.
Based in Hong Kong, the role blends elements of research and networking, product design and management, and content strategy.
For almost 40 years, Risk.net has helped track - and set - the agenda at the world's largest financial institutions, with a particular focus on the derivatives markets. We are a rare beast: a financial industry publication that thrives on long-form investigative journalism, in-depth market coverage, and quant finance research that carries real impact in the industry.
As our coverage has evolved to incorporate more data-driven stories, we have also been building our own proprietary datasets, some drawn from publicly available sources, others from private contributions to our benchmarking services. Your primary role will be to own, expand and deepen these relationships.
The successful candidate will be comfortable talking to senior individuals and teams at these firms, developing a thorough understanding of their needs. Your findings will be shared with colleagues in a clear and concise manner, helping to shape our products. As our datasets grow, you will help curate and maintain them, as well as identifying new ways to present information and insights back to our contributors and subscribers.
Key Tasks And Responsibilities- Build and maintain relationships with key stakeholders in the financial services industry, particularly senior risk managers at large banks and buy-side firms;
- Develop reliable contacts. Identify and approach potential new contributors;
- Help to refine our coverage. Proactively identify new content opportunities and product enhancements that fit with Risk.net's wider editorial offering;
- Collaborate with internal stakeholders, including in-house developers, designers, and marketing teams;
- Collect and verify data for benchmarking products. Respond to queries from subscribers and prospects about our products;
- Stay up-to-date on industry trends and developments, as well as changing demands for information within a range of financial services firms;
- Ideally, some experience in a role with similar skills - research or product management, for example;
- Excellent communication skills and a proven ability to build and maintain relationships with internal and external stakeholders;
- Solid understanding of the financial services industry;
- Ability to work both independently and as part of a team;
- Experience of using online survey platforms would be an advantage, as would an awareness of how LLMs and other AI tools could help automate some aspects of data collection and curation;
- Strong Excel skills would also be an advantage;
